Forced Labor

Forced Labor is a global issue. While U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) has done an admirable job at detaining cargo to assess applicability of law to certain goods, the scope of enforcement has been lacking. More equitable enforcement is needed.

Made in America

Many energy companies fraudulently claim to be made in the USA or assembled in the USA in violation of the FTC’s Made in the USA Labeling Rule. These companies gain a significant marketing advantage vis-à-vis their competitors while deceiving American consumers.

ENVIRONMENTAL

Not all green energy is clean. Some green energy components contain toxic substances, which put miners in danger and threaten the environment and groundwater supplies. Renewable energy has a lifespan and responsible decommission protocols are necessary to protect the environment

Tariffs

To promote fair trade and reduce global greenhouse gases, the U.S. should encourage solar production at home and abroad.  Poorly designed tariffs which inhibit friendshoring and limit renewable energy deployment compromise global climate objectives.
